Forestry Ministry imposes new conditions on logs for re-exportThursday, May 24, 2012 The Ministry of Forestry and the Environment on behalf of its technical Department of Forestry and in collaboration with Forest Users Association has announced that effective May 25th, 2012, new conditions will be applied on logs for re-export in The Gambia. According to a media release issued yesterday by MoFEN, effective May 25th, all logs that are imported and meant for re-export are not allowed to enter The Gambia beyond Kalagi and Barra villages. It further added that any vehicle or conveyer that is found entering The Gambia beyond the designated entry point (Kalagi and Barra) will not be accepted. “The wood and the conveyer will be confiscated and the culprit be taken to law and we urge all and sundry to abide to the conditions given,” the release concluded.
